Asperger Syndrome - Personal Assessments
Diagnosis for adults who suspect they have Asperger Syndrome are notoriously difficult to obtain or expensive. We provide assessments which follow the same process as a formal diagnosis, including a comprehensive report of the assessment process and outcome. Feedback about our assessment process and report from a senior psychiatrist confirmed that the standard and complexity is comparable to a medical diagnosis. However, as Asperger Syndrome is a medical condition, only diagnosable by a clinical practitioner, these assessments cannot be claimed to be a 'diagnosis'. Any non-medical practitioner claiming otherwise is incorrect. The assessment and report may be useful in providing evidence in seeking further diagnosis, or may be enough in its own right to confirm the suspicions of the individual. Dyslexia - Personal Assessments
We are able to provide Adult Dyslexia Assessments for individuals and educational establishments. This takes around 3-4 hours and involves a range of assessment tests and methods and is carried out by a qualified dyslexia assessor. These assessments are not the equivalent to those carried out by an Educational Psychologist but are a legitimate diagnosis.
